This position requires a DoD Clearance •$10,000 Sign-On Bonus ______________________________________________________________________________Responsibilities:
Plan, oversee, operate, and maintain video conferencing equipment in support of Missile Defense Agency (MDA) events, including AV Control System programming and testing Provide VTC event planning packages (test plans, engineering assessments, configuration drawings, accreditation documentation, etc.) as requested Oversee VTC Maintenance Crew in delivering VTC and A/V operational support and facilitation Oversee VTC Maintenance Crew in maintaining VTC-unique hardware, software, and peripherals (e.g., TelePresence, CODEC, AV, Gateways, TMS, Monitors, Projectors, AMX Panels) Oversee VTC Maintenance Crew in utilizing incident management tracking tools (e.g., Remedy) for all maintenance activities Monitor MDA's Remedy Application and assign maintenance tasks to individual Crew Members Oversee VTC Maintenance Crew in maintaining equipment per Information Assurance guidance from manufacturers and Government (e.g., CERTIAVM, DISA
) Oversee VTC Maintenance Crew in troubleshooting and resolving collaboration and business application incidents Plan and oversee preventative maintenance services per manufacturer-recommended schedules and SOPs Implement and execute configuration management plans, processes, and procedures Oversee maintenance of MDA collaboration systems and all associated VTC peripheral equipment (VBIII Auditorium, future operations/control centers); maintain/procure manufacturer service and maintenance agreements Manage, plan, design, coordinate, integrate, and implement future collaboration services and equipment (including procurement, testing, and acceptance) Manage COMSEC materials and procedures to ensure VTC systems are operational and properly keyed for secure events; maintain accountability of electronic keying material and CCI equipment; comply with access control procedures Stay current with advancing technologies and provide recommendations for new technologies and technology refresh to the Government Prepare, review, coordinate, update, and submit DIACAP supporting documentationRequirements:
Education High school diploma required College degree preferred but not required Experience 5+ years of experience in the Audio-Visual industry Extensive experience with AV control system installation, programming, and troubleshooting Experience programming both AMX (Netlinx Studio) and Extron (Visual Studio) control systems Experience with Cisco systems installation, maintenance, and troubleshooting Experience with desktop and conference room VTC systems in a secure government or military environment Technical Knowledge Strong understanding of computer networking, including configuration of Cisco Network Switches Working knowledge of AV concepts (acoustics, lighting, aspect ratios, font size vs. distance, scan rates, video standards, and transmission systems) Working knowledge of TEMPEST standards and IA concerns for multi-classification multimedia systems Knowledge and experience with computer network configuration Familiarity with Microsoft Windows and Office products Cisco Call Manager experience (a plus) Understanding of electrical current (a plus) Soft Skills Extremely meticulous and organized working style Ability to work effectively as part of a team Strong team leadership qualities Strong verbal and written communication skills Certifications (Preferred) CompTIA Security+ CEDIA Certification CTS Certification CTS-D Certification CTS-I Certification NMR Consulting is an Equal Opportunity Employer (EOE).
